What is the Resource Generator?

The Resource Generator allows all users to quickly and easily:
  • Find and use training and assessment resources and links
  • Assemble resources into a single "resource kit"
  • Personalise these resource kits for individual learners
  • Download or print these resource kits.
As a registered user you can also:
  • Use your own home page to save your resource kits and links
  • Include your own training and assessment resources
  • Create a group to share information and resources with your colleagues
